WebMay 19, 2024 · To clear the entire Clipboard history, click any set of three dots (ellipses) in the list and a menu will pop up. Select “Clear All.”. Any remaining items on the list after you click “Clear All” are pinned in place. If you’d like to remove a pinned item, click the ellipses beside it and select “Unpin.”.
